Pesticides are in the air we breathe, the water we drink, the food we eat, the flowers we touch and the sea we swim in. This consumer guide to pesticides highlights the dangers and provides guidelines for safe living. Aimed at the layman, the book is divided into two sections. The first part of the book answers the most commonly asked questions on pesticides. This is followed by a guide to pesticides and food safety. Presented in the form of a table, this section lists the 50 key food groups (dairy products, root vegetables, soft fruits, etc), pinpointing the pesticides that can be found on or in them. The section outlines those most likely to cause harm and offers suggestions for alternatives.
